department-of-veterans-affairs / va.gov-team

Public resources for building on and in support of VA.gov. Visit complete Knowledge Hub:
https://depo-platform-documentation.scrollhelp.site/index.html
284 stars 206 forks source link

Appointment List Re-design - Voiceover isn’t reliably reading details links #54098

Closed ldelacosta closed 1 year ago

ldelacosta commented 1 year ago

Description

Product and Design team are looking to update the appointment list to help the Veteran better understand the details for their appointment


Acceptance Criteria

Background: the va_online_scheduling_appointment_list toggle is on

Problems found:

Example:

https://user-images.githubusercontent.com/2536801/221261803-d293af44-b288-4efb-b9e8-4a1b732ce7d5.mov

To recreate:

Proposed solution:

Design Assets

All spec copy is FPO. Use copy in copy doc. Screenreader spec

Definition of Done


outerpress commented 1 year ago

@ldelacosta this ticket is good to go (the design spec is should be ready by early next week.)

ldelacosta commented 1 year ago

@outerpress @Cieramaddox - this ticket is ready to be validated in staging. Please let me know if you run into any issues. Thanks!

outerpress commented 1 year ago

@ldelacosta @vbahinwillit This worked great on Past and Upcoming appointments. For Pending it's still just announcing "Link: Details." I tried clearing my cache, lmk if there's anything else I should try on my side.

ldelacosta commented 1 year ago

@outerpress @Cieramaddox - ready to be tested in staging.

outerpress commented 1 year ago

@ldelacosta pending is announcing the aria label now, looks good!

ldelacosta commented 1 year ago

No new issues reported. Closing out the ticket.